What is a substation & why do we need one?

Substations are the backbone of power transmission infrastructure, converting and distributing electricity generated by solar farms to the grid. Why do solar power plants need a substation?

Reactive Power Compensation: Solar power plants can impact the balance of reactive power in the grid. Substations help regulate this through capacitors and reactors, maintaining voltage stability and reducing transmission losses.
